The Goddelau outdoor swimming pool's support association is hosting its traditional beach volleyball tournament for amateur teams. The focus is not only on competitive spirit, but above all on fun and a good atmosphere.
Numerous recreational teams will compete against each other on the two beach volleyball courts. The defending champions are the team "Fürst von Schmetternicht" (Prince of Butterfly-Not), who aim to repeat their success from last year. They will be challenged by teams with well-known names such as "Time to Weiz" and the "Flamongos".
Even teams not competing for the top spots don't go home empty-handed. Traditionally, there's also a competition for the "Golden Pineapple," which includes a bottle of non-alcoholic sparkling wine.
The tournament is supported by the Darmstadt-based private brewery Braustüb'l. The winning team will receive a brewery tour in Darmstadt as the main prize.
